Tory MP Paul Scully had the unenviable task of trying to defend Boris Johnson’s latest public flouting of Covid rules, when he faced Adil Ray on GMB.
Here’s how that worked out for him.

Haggis_UK helpfully picked out the key exchange.
Adil Ray – Why are we not telling people to wear a mask?
Paul Scully – We want people to use common sense
Adil Ray – Boris Johnson was pictured on a train maskless… so Boris Johnson has no common sense?
PS – That's what newspapers do
AR – So it's the newspapers fault#GMB pic.twitter.com/wYrTvfyNc7
